The pelvic floor is a group of muscles and ligaments that support the pelvic organs, including the bladder, uterus, and rectum. When these muscles weaken or are damaged, it can lead to several disorders:
Pelvic Organ Prolapse (POP): This occurs when pelvic organs descend from their normal position into or out of the vagina. POP can affect the bladder (cystocele), uterus (uterine prolapse), or rectum (rectocele).
Urinary Incontinence: The involuntary loss of urine. Stress incontinence (leakage during physical activity) and urge incontinence (sudden, strong urge to urinate) are common types.
Fecal Incontinence: The inability to control bowel movements.
Pelvic Pain: Chronic pain in the pelvic region, which can have various underlying causes.
These conditions often arise due to childbirth, aging, menopause, chronic coughing, or heavy lifting. What should you actually do if you experience these symptoms? Seeking medical advice promptly is crucial.

Physicians in Kolkata employ various surgical techniques, tailored to the specific condition and the individual patient's needs. These range from traditional open surgeries to minimally invasive approaches.
Minimally invasive surgery is often preferred due to smaller incisions, reduced pain, and quicker recovery times. These include:
Laparoscopic Surgery: Using a small camera and instruments inserted through tiny cuts.
Robotic Surgery: A more advanced form of laparoscopic surgery, offering enhanced precision and control for the surgeon.

Vaginal Hysterectomy/Reconstruction: Removal or repair of the uterus through the vagina, often combined with prolapse repair.
Sacrocolpopexy: A procedure to support the vaginal vault (top of the vagina) after hysterectomy, using mesh or tissue. As per AIIMS guidelines, mesh use is carefully considered for its long-term efficacy and potential complications.
Sling Procedures: For stress urinary incontinence, slings (made of synthetic material or the patient's own tissue) are used to support the urethra.
Colporrhaphy: Repair of the vaginal walls to correct cystocele or rectocele.

Recovery time varies depending on the procedure's complexity and the surgical approach used. Minimally invasive surgeries typically require 2-6 weeks for recovery, while open surgeries may take longer. Following your doctor's post-operative instructions is vital for optimal healing.
Surgical repairs aim to provide long-term support and symptom relief. While recurrence is possible, a successful surgery significantly improves quality of life. Maintaining a healthy weight and avoiding strenuous activities can help preserve the repair.
Robotic surgery offers enhanced precision and visualization, which can be beneficial for complex repairs. However, the best approach depends on individual patient factors and the surgeon's expertise. Your doctor will recommend the most suitable method for your specific situation.
